Georgian Dream assessed the situation in the country before the elections


Georgian Dream does not expect aggravation of the situation in the republic after the presidential election, ruling party MP Shota Khabareli told Izvestia.
"Everything will be according to plan, we will elect a president, there will be no complications, no one will interfere with us. We will definitely go in our direction even if there are protests," he said.
Presidential elections in the republic will be held on December 14.
